Ethical Considerations
Fair Play in Gaming
Cheating and Imbalance: One of the primary ethical concerns in the gaming industry is the impact of purchasing real money on the game's balance and fairness. When players can acquire in-game currency or products, it can create an unequal playing field, where those with more financial resources have an unjust advantage.
Neighborhood Impact: Such practices can also deteriorate the sense of neighborhood and reasonable play that numerous games aim to cultivate. Players who strive to make their in-game rewards might feel demotivated when others can merely buy their way to the top.
Consumer Protection
Scams and Scams: The digital market is swarming with frauds and fraudulent activities. When individuals buy real money, they risk falling victim to these plans, losing their hard-earned money without getting the promised value in return.
Openness and Regulation: Ethical businesses should offer clear and transparent information about the terms and conditions of their deals. Nevertheless, in unregulated markets, consumers typically lack the required securities.
Effect on the Economy
Inflation and Market Distortion: In digital economies, the injection of real money can lead to inflation, where the value of in-game items or currencies decreases as more individuals buy them. This can misshape the marketplace and develop financial instability.
Resource Allocation: The capability to buy real money can cause ineffective allocation of resources, where players invest more in in-game purchases than in other, possibly more useful, activities.
Legal Implications
Regulatory Frameworks
National and International Laws: The legality of purchasing real money differs by country and jurisdiction. In some places, it is strictly controlled or perhaps forbidden, specifically when it involves unlicensed monetary services or money laundering.
Gaming Industry Standards: Many gaming platforms have their own guidelines and guidelines concerning the purchase of in-game currency. Breaking these rules can lead to account bans or other charges.
Money Laundering
Meaning: Money laundering is the process of making illegally obtained money appear legal. This can include buying real money through digital platforms to obscure the origin of the funds.
Legal Consequences: Engaging in money laundering can lead to serious legal charges, including fines and jail time. Digital platforms are progressively under scrutiny to prevent such activities.
Tax
Digital Transactions: In numerous countries, digital deals including real money undergo tax. This includes the sale of in-game products for real money, which can be thought about a taxable event.
Cryptocurrency: The tax ramifications of cryptocurrency transactions are complicated and differ by jurisdiction. Individuals must know their legal responsibilities to report and pay taxes on such deals.
